Job Summary

Caterpillar’s Autonomy & Autonomation Site Solutions organization is seeking a Manager, Engineering Technology to provide deep technical leadership across the MineStar Office ecosystem. This role is accountable for setting architectural direction, driving technical strategy, and ensuring successful delivery of scalable, high‑quality solutions that support mining operations worldwide.

This is a hands‑on technical leadership role, combining software architecture expertise, mining domain knowledge, and people leadership. As a member of the Site Solutions leadership team, the Manager, Engineering Technology plays a critical role in shaping solution and system architecture, ensuring alignment with business strategy, customer needs, and long‑term platform evolution.
